Rann

Perks of being an UA paladin:
-soul driver
-spirit thingie
-able to wear equips 10 levels higher
-start at level 50

Soul Driver becomes pretty useless due to its slow casting and nerf'ed damage, you don't really use it after getting Charge Blow (except maybe in certain stages of PQs were vertical mobbing > horizontal mobbing). The spirit thingie is not that helpful at all; oh yeah sure, it might help you finish off a mob with little hp but then again, it tends to trigger unwanted mobs as well. Being able to wear equips 10 levels higher is pretty much useless once you reached lvl 130 (assuming your end-games are empress equips) and getting to lvl 50 in a day is a piece of cake nowadays.

Conclusion: If you already have a lvl 120 KOC and thinking about making an UA paladin, do it; if you are thinking about making and training a koc just for an UA paladin, you might as well just make a regular paladin.
